On February 17, 1979, the song "King Rocker - 2002 Remaster" was released by Generation X. The duration of This song is about two minutes long, specifically at 2:17. This song does not appear to have any foul language. King Rocker - 2002 Remaster's duration is considered a little bit shorter than the average duration of a typical track. This song is part of Valley of the Dolls (2002 Remaster) by Generation X. The song's track number on the album is #5 out of 12 tracks. Based on our data, United Kingdom was the country where this track was produced or recorded. Since King Rocker - 2002 Remaster by Generation X has a tempo of 144 beats per a minute, the tempo markings of this song would be Allegro (fast, quick, and bright). With King Rocker - 2002 Remaster being at 144 BPM, the half-time would be 72 BPM with a double-time of 288 BPM.In addition, we consider the tempo speed to be pretty fast for this song. This makes this song perfect for activities such as, jogging or cycling. The time signature for this track is 4/4.
